Mr. Price seconded the JlK)tion, which carried unani.1rously. <br /> <br />IN MEMJRIAM - HCMARD NEMEROV <br /> <br />Mr. Schoomer said University City and the larger ccmmmity were very saddened <br />by the death of Mr. Howard Nemerov, Hearst Professor of English at Washington <br />University, Poet laureate of the united states for two years, winner of the <br />National Book Award, the National Book critics Circle Award and many other <br />honors, and a University city resident since 1968. Mr. Schoamer said Mr. <br />Nemerov was a good. neighbor and good citizen and he will be terribly missed. <br />Mayor Majerus said this is indeed a loss, but the ccmmmity is much richer <br />because of his presence for so many years. <br /> <br />AProIN'IMENTSIREAProIN'IMENTS <br /> <br />Mrs. Schuman moved the appointJnent of Dr. Carolyn Orange, 959 Abbeville, to <br />the Human Relations Commission for an unexpired tenn ending August 6, 1992. <br />Mr. Wagner seconded the motion, which carried unani.1rously. <br /> <br />Mr. Schoomer moved that Mr. Adam Casmier, 7426 Stanford, be appointed to the <br />Library Board for a tenn expiring June 30, 1994.
